Museums & science parks

PlanetObserver works with museums and science parks from all over the world. Projects range from supply of satellite images on demand, thematic exhibitions, such as "The Earth from space : Observations for the future", to printed floor maps and PlanetObserver3D, an efficient virtual globe programme.

We work either directly with museums or with scenography and museography agencies in charge of setting up exhibitions.

puce titre h2 Museums and science parks (France)

Vulcania
The Planet unveiled", Vulcania theme park’s main attraction, invites visitors to a real-time virtual voyage to discover planet Earth’s diversity from space. This attraction is entirely based on PlanetObserver3D virtual globe.
France Miniature
PlanetObserver has produced a large scale exhibition for the leisure park "France Miniature". Large size floor map printed with the world satellite image and high quality displays focusing on French overseas territories make up this unique exhibition presented for the 20th anniversary of the park.
Conservatoire du Littoral
The 35-year anniversary of the Conservatoire du Littoral has been celebrated with a printed floor map from PlanetObserver displaying the satellite image of France (linoleum floor map, size 9m²).
Cité des Sciences
PlanetObserver satellite images are perfect to display climate change simulations in the exhibition CLIMAX.
Cité des Télécoms
The Cité des Télécoms exhibition space dedicated to spatial telecommunications integrates two exhibits provided by PlanetObserver : a 4-meter diameter satellite image of Brittany printed on a floor, and a 25-meter long perspective satellite view of Europe.
Palais de la Découverte
The exhibition "Between Land and Sea, Focus on the French coastline" presented for the 30-year anniversary of the Conservatoire du Littoral displays 30 large format satellite images of the French coastlines, a 80m² satellite floor map of France and a selection of the most striking coastlines around the world.

puce titre h2 Museums and science parks (international)

Natural Science Museum - Belgium
PlanetObserver3D virtual globe is used to illustrate biodiversity issues at the Belgian Natural Science Museum.
Miraikan - Japan
PlanetObserver global satellite imagery is used in Geo-Cosmos, a 6.5-meter diameter globe which is the symbol exhibit of Miraikan, Japan’s major Science Museum.
La Caixa - Barcelona
PlanetObserver3D virtual globe is the centrepiece of an exhibition on Biodiversity presented by La Caixa Foundation Science Museum in Barcelona (Spain).
Sciencentre - South Africa
The Southern part of Africa is displayed on a 32m² satellite floor map made of PVC tiles.
